As with other large world cities like Greater New York City and large national cities like Toronto, the legal geographic boundaries of Montreal have been reorganized to incorporate adjacent communities which are integral to its social and economic life. But due to the history of both the Anglo majority in ruling elite in Downtown Montreal but living in the western adjacent towns like Westmount existing with the working class francophone community, the move toward agglomeration was rife with political controversy and linguistic strife.
